·3 years agoeBay has been "experimenting" with requiring pre-authorization of payment for Best Offers for over a year and a half, adding more and more users into the test group required to do so (sellers can opt their listings out of it; buyers cannot opt out once they are assigned). Too many users were making offers and then not paying when it was accepted, and too many of those were scammers who would try to get the seller to text or email them to get their number/email address to send fake payment messages to.
Not sure whether or not they have officially made it permanent yet or it continues "experimentally." They have recently started trying it out on auction bids.
